Russian missiles rained down on the Ukrainian city of Odessa for a second day Tuesday, in an apparent effort to destroy supply lines and target Western weapons shipments.The strikes on the historic port in the southwest of Ukraine came as US Director of National Intelligence Avril Haines told the Senate Armed Services Committee that the Kremlin had not given up on its hopes to take large swaths of Ukraine.“We assess President [Vladimir] Putin is preparing for a prolonged conflict in Ukraine during which he still intends to achieve goals beyond the Donbas,” Haines told lawmakers Tuesday.
